Irohas Photo Sydney is your premier professional film lab in the heart of Sydney CBD (Haymarket). We specialize in fast, high-quality analog film developing, scanning, and printing. Our Services: * Same-Day Developing: Reliable speed for C-41 color negative film. * Disposable Cameras: Expert processing for all single-use cameras. * Pro Formats: Comprehensive handling of 35mm & 120 film, including Black & White and E-6 slide film. * Print & Scan: High-resolution scanning and professional photo printing. Visit our Haymarket store to browse fresh film stocks and quality second-hand cameras. Walk-ins are always welcome!
